Single Entrance: Monemvasia Winery is named after a towering 300-metre high rock off the Peloponnese coast. This natural fortress, linked to the shore by a single bridge, perfectly embodies its name, meaning 'only entrance.'
Ancient Greek Gem: Meet Kydonitsa, a rare, ancient Greek variety that means 'little quince.' True to its name, it delivers quince and delicate floral notes, giving it a Viognier-like quality.
Tasting Note
This refreshing Kydonitsa offers fresh apricot, quince, and orange blossom, with added texture from aging on its lees for six months. There's a pithiness to the palate, balanced by excellent fruit concentration, that adds complexity, leading to a clean, crisp finish.
